Job description:
As a Trained Medication Aide at Samaritan Bethany, you will:
- Administers and documents medications and treatments within their scope of practice.
- Assists residents with all activities of daily living
- Provides care that maintains each resident at the highest possible level of their ability.
Requirements:
- Must be 18 years or older
- Must be on MN Nursing Assistant Registry
- Completion of an accredited course in Medication Administration for Unlicensed Personnel
